History
Waldhaus is a brewery in Weilheim, Baden-Württemberg, Germany, operating under the name Privatbrauerei Waldhaus. The brewery was opened in 1833, establishing the beginning of the business's documented history. A major ownership transition occurred in 1894, when Johann Schmid acquired Waldhaus. The acquisition placed the brewery in the Schmid family and began a period of family ownership that, according to the reference material, has continued since then. This continuity distinguishes Waldhaus from breweries whose ownership moved among larger industrial groups or public companies.
